'Anywhere but Here' is the new novel from Irish author and former journalist Vicki Notaro. The book follows three friends in their 40s who take a trip to Donegal for some much-needed soul searching. In this episode Notaro tells Róisin Ingle how female friendship and the pressure to live the perfect life, served as the inspiration for the book. In this wide-ranging conversation the pair also talk about Notaro's struggles with anxiety and PMDD, as well as the joy of being childfree.
But first, Irish Times podcast producer Suzanne Brennan is here to discuss some of the biggest stories of the week, including last weekend’s fatal crash on the M9, the worrying rise in spiking incidents and the final of this year’s Rose of Tralee.
